Safety, trust & environment

—Safety, Trust, & Environment— I consider myself caring, conscientious, and communicative. Safety and health are my top priorities! I strongly prefer to have meet and greets before booking any service to ensure that we are all a good fit. If I notice anything out of the ordinary during a visit or stay, I will immediately contact you with photos (even if they're gross). •  I will always stay the full 30 minutes of a visit (unless we have agreed on a different arrangement). I will try to engage with any pet, but will not force interaction if they are acting nervous. Sometimes just a calm nearby presence can be enough comfort for a particularly shy kitty! I have dealt with many anxious pets over the years, but I have found that earning their trust is the best reward in itself! •  I strongly prefer harnesses, Martingales, or head collars paired with short (4'-6') leashes for walks. I ensure that all equipment is snugly fitted and without any fraying/damage before we head out the door. If you only have a flat collar and/or retractable leash available, I will use my own double-ended leash that I keep in my car. •  Dogs are not allowed off-leash except for in their own fully fenced-in yards. Exceptions are only allowed for homes with invisible fences (though I will still go outside with and supervise them, and bring them inside if I see a person and/or other dog going for a walk coming up the street) and for exceptionally obedient dogs with whom I have a well established relationship and explicit, written consent from the owner. • I will not bring dogs to dog parks, even if they are empty, due to the liability. Similarly, I will keep a safe distance from any other dogs on walks and even decline requests from strangers to pet them if you so wish. I also do not accept visits for cats who will be able to go outdoors on their own when I am not there. • Please let me know if you are expecting any maintenance work, landscapers, etc. while I am scheduled to be at your house. (I have been locked out by contractors before.)

A typical day

You will receive photos from each and every walk/visit! If it looks like it will rain, I ask that you leave a towel out to dry off paws and tummies. In warmer weather, I bring water and portable water bowls on walks and give breaks every 15-20 minutes. If it is hotter than ~75°, I will only do half-hour walks and shorter to prevent overheating. If it is hotter than ~80-85° or colder than ~20-25° (breed-dependent), I will only do drop-in visits (potty break + indoor playtime). I keep a variety of balls/Chuck-Its, cat toys, leashes, poop bags, and even a cat harness in my car at all times, so I am prepared for any situation!
